Transaction 16723b4937d86d0b6d901109d7eae076319bcc6bc260f5708e23e25f2fcf8ad9

48 Input
1 Outputs
  • 16723b4937d86d0b6d901109d7eae076319bcc6bc260f5708e23e25f2fcf8ad9:0
  • value  1064000000
    address  3MGdeqnS4h3hRWM5VqMLHFzwgJy6c1Zz9b